Output 283ba685edc6b9b32f92b337108ba09038056d1b0a08bd744af196a41da4f288:0

value
35228502
script pubkey
OP_0 OP_PUSHBYTES_20 50ef95e9ffc6456ec71310e74c09723f230c97c2
address
bc1q2rhet60lcezka3cnzrn5cztj8u3se97z8axy7c
transaction
283ba685edc6b9b32f92b337108ba09038056d1b0a08bd744af196a41da4f288
confirmations
170025
spent
true